Arbel National Park and Nature Reserve is situated in the Lower Galilee region near Tiberias, Israel, and offers stunning views of the Sea of Galilee. It encompasses Mount Arbel, which stands out with its sheer cliffs and impressive height dominating the landscape. The park blends rich historical significance with natural beauty; it holds ancient ruins, including those of a fortress atop the mountain, caves that once served as hideouts, and a synagogue dating back to the Byzantine era. Visitors to the Arbel can hike along marked trails that range in difficulty, with paths leading to panoramic viewpoints, steep climbs, or gentle walks through the fields. The vista from the cliff tops is breathtaking, overlooking the Golan Heights, Mount Hermon and the Sea of Galilee. Flora and fauna thrive in the Mediterranean climate, with wildflowers in the spring and eagles soaring above. Archeological sites tell stories of the region's diverse historical tapestry, from Jewish rebels to the Crusaders. The reserve's combination of natural beauty, history, and hiking opportunities makes it a destination for nature lovers and history enthusiasts alike.
